This nourishing combination of veggies and oats is ideal for a speedy breakfast or dinner. Oat groats are minimally processed oats that have a heartier texture than your typical breakfast oat; they also contain more soluble fiber than any other grain. Ingredients

  • 1 tablespoon coconut oil
  • 1/4 cup chopped sweet onion
  • 1/4 cup chopped broccoli
  • 3/4 cup cooked sprouted oat groats (or brown rice or rolled oats)
  • 1/2 cup spinach
  • 1/4 cup kale
  • 1/4 cup finely diced zucchini
  • 1/4 teaspoon Herbamare or salt

Directions

  1. Heat coconut oil in sauté pan over medium heat. Add onion and cook until translucent, about 2 minutes. Add broccoli and toss with onion.
  2. Add oat groats, spinach, kale, and zucchini. Season with Herbamare or salt. Toss until well mixed. Cover pan until broccoli and zucchini are tender, about 3 to 4 minutes.
